Carbohydrates are often considered to be the bad guys in the world of weight and fitness. Many people tend to avoid carbohydrates, especially if they are dealing with PCOS. But, do you know that carbohydrates are not bad for health, and they are essential for providing energy to the body? In fact, carbohydrates should be a part of our daily diet. Now, the question arises – how many carbohydrates should one consume in a day? Well, the answer is not easy as it depends on various factors such as age, gender, height, weight, activity level, and health status. According to the American Diabetes Association, the recommended daily intake of carbohydrates is approximately 45-60% of the total calories consumed in a day. For an adult on a 2000-calorie diet, the daily intake of carbohydrates should be around 225-325 grams. But, this number varies from person to person and should be determined by a healthcare professional. If you are dealing with PCOS, it is essential to control your carbohydrate intake as it can affect insulin resistance, which is a common symptom of PCOS. But, that doesn’t mean you need to avoid carbs altogether. Instead, you should focus on consuming healthier carbs that are high in fiber and low in glycemic index. These carbs are slowly absorbed by the body, leading to a gradual rise in blood sugar levels, thus reducing insulin resistance. Some of the best sources of healthy carbs include whole grains, fruits, vegetables, legumes, and nuts. These foods are not only rich in carbs but also contain vital nutrients, vitamins, and minerals that are essential for overall health. When consuming carbohydrates, it is essential to keep a check on portion sizes. Eating too much of anything, even healthy carbs, can lead to weight gain and other health problems. A healthy meal should contain a balanced mix of carbohydrates, protein, and healthy fats. In conclusion, carbohydrates are not bad for health, and they should be a part of our daily diet. However, it is essential to consume healthy carbs and monitor portion sizes to maintain a healthy weight and manage PCOS symptoms. Consult a healthcare professional to determine your daily carbohydrate intake.
